α-MnO_2纳米线吸附染料废水的动力学研究 被引量:1

Study on the Dynamics of Dye Wastewater Adsorption Using α-MnO_2 Nanowires

摘要 通过水热一步合成了α-MnO2纳米线,采用静态吸附法研究吸附剂的用量、吸附时间对α-MnO2吸附刚果红的影响,且随吸附剂含量的增大,平衡吸附量减小,到达平衡的时间短。 α-MnO2 nanowires have been synthesized via facile one-step hydrothermal route. The factors of influence adsorption had been investigated by static adsorption including sorbent dosage and adsorption time. The results showed that the equilibrium adsorbing capacity decrease with the increase of adsorbent, and the equilibrium can be reached quickly.
